Finally had detailer put on ceramic coat: 16 months and ~14,000km (8,700 miles) later, just in time to park it for the winter months. Same detailer did total wrap right after car purchased but said to wait a year for ceramic coat, for best results. Detailer also cleaned/treated interior n/c so I left a $200 tip, with car looking brand new again. Detailer said car received many compliments while in its shop. Surprisingly, 2 of their younger employees correctly ID'd it as a Lotus Emira right away. It turns out the Emira is their car choice when gaming, due to its weight to HP ratio (see below). Who knew?
